Understanding Life Insurance Options

When selecting life insurance for parents, it's essential to understand the different types available. The two primary types are term life insurance and permanent life insurance.

Term Life Insurance

Term life insurance provides coverage for a specified period. It's generally more affordable and ideal for those who need coverage for a specific time frame.

Permanent Life Insurance

Permanent life insurance, including whole and universal life policies, offers lifelong coverage and often includes a cash value component.

Key Benefits of Life Insurance for Parents

  • Financial Security: Provides peace of mind knowing that financial obligations will be covered.
  • Inheritance Planning: Helps in leaving a legacy for children and grandchildren.
  • Debt Coverage: Assists in covering any outstanding debts, such as a mortgage.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Policy

  1. Age and Health: Premiums are often influenced by the age and health of the insured.
  2. Coverage Amount: Determine the necessary coverage to meet potential future expenses.
  3. Policy Duration: Consider how long the coverage should last to best suit your parents' needs.

FAQ

What is the best type of life insurance for parents?

The best type of life insurance depends on your parents' specific needs, financial situation, and the period they wish to be covered. Term life insurance is suitable for short-term needs, while permanent life insurance is better for lifelong coverage.

How much coverage should parents have?

The coverage amount should be enough to cover any debts, final expenses, and provide financial support for dependents. A financial advisor can help determine the appropriate amount based on individual circumstances.

Are there age limits for life insurance policies?

Most insurers have age limits, especially for term policies. It's crucial to compare options and consider purchasing insurance sooner rather than later to avoid restrictions.
